Understanding what typically causes water damage in Lyndeborough can help you catch a problem early — before it turns into a full emergency call.
Supply lines behind washing machines, dishwashers, and refrigerators wear out over time. When they fail, water can spread through a Lyndeborough property for hours before anyone notices, soaking into flooring and cabinetry.
Heavy storms, wind-driven rain, and aging roofing materials all contribute to water intrusion in Lyndeborough homes and businesses, especially in older roof systems nearing the end of their lifespan.
Clogged municipal lines, tree root intrusion, and sump pump failures can send contaminated water back into Lyndeborough basements and lower levels, requiring specialized cleanup and sanitizing.
A slowly failing water heater in a Lyndeborough home can leak for weeks before it's discovered, often causing more structural damage than a sudden pipe burst would.
Improper grading around a Lyndeborough property's foundation can direct rainwater toward the structure instead of away from it, leading to chronic basement or crawlspace moisture over time.
After a fire is out, the water used to fight it often causes its own separate restoration need across affected Lyndeborough floors and rooms, sometimes worse than the fire itself.

A shop vac and a few fans can make a Lyndeborough property look dry on the surface — but "looks dry" and "is actually dry" are two very different things.
What makes DIY cleanup risky isn't the initial mop-up — it's everything you can't see afterward. Standard household fans move air across a surface, but they don't pull moisture out of building materials the way commercial-grade air movers and dehumidifiers do. That gap is exactly where Lyndeborough homeowners end up with mold problems weeks or months down the line.
Insurance carriers generally want to see documented proof that a water loss was properly mitigated. A DIY cleanup rarely produces that kind of record, which can leave Lyndeborough homeowners exposed if related damage — like mold or warped subfloor — shows up months later and the carrier questions whether it was handled correctly the first time.
None of this means every spill needs a professional crew — a small, contained, surface-level spill that's dried within a few hours is usually fine to handle yourself. But once water has soaked into flooring, baseboards, or drywall, or if it's been sitting for more than a few hours, it's worth a call to make sure nothing's hiding beneath the surface.
The minutes before our Lyndeborough crew arrives matter. Here's what our dispatchers typically recommend, situation permitting.
If the water is coming from a pipe, appliance, or fixture you can safely reach, shut off the supply valve or main.
Never touch electrical switches, outlets, or appliances that are wet or near standing water — the risk of shock is real.
Lifting rugs, moving boxes, and relocating valuables can reduce secondary damage while you wait for our team.
Snap photos or video of the affected areas before anything is moved — this helps your insurance claim later.
If weather allows, opening windows or doors can help slow humidity buildup until our Lyndeborough team arrives with drying equipment.
